Transaction e66a338a8638420c7646351cf270d71ab8210cf7cdeccb0e5a8d662268f03434
1 Input
1 Output
-
e66a338a8638420c7646351cf270d71ab8210cf7cdeccb0e5a8d662268f03434:0
- value
- 1184376
- script pubkey
- OP_0 OP_PUSHBYTES_20 095684c6f8b5159a78185654bb0b9e9e6a325185
- address
- bc1qp9tgf3hck52e57qc2e2tkzu7ne4ry5v9e2hgh3